Elder Care Options--Help When You Need It

Many of us will one day find ourselves in the position of needing care for our self or a loved one. Luckily, our community has more resources than ever before. This valuable workshop demystifies the maze of services and options, enabling you to find the best match for you or your family member. Learn about alternative living situations, transportation, nutritional and medical services, in-home care including home-health and hospice as well as how to access these options. Discover costs of each and the role of Medicare, Medicaid, LTC insurance, and other funding options. Instructor Debbie Gann has worked in the healthcare field for over twenty years and is currently director of Home Attendant Care in Bellingham and Vice Chairperson of the Alzheimer Society of Washington. She invites you to bring your questions.
